    Thanks folks! I have found that having a strong idea, over time, of what you want will somehow swing the universe over to your side. Getting to know shop keepers, and taking time to smooze with garage sale folks will sometimes ring up a winner. In this case I went to an estate/garage/house sale and talked with the owner. His grand folks were downsizing. So he led me through two houses, a backyard shed and a couple basements. Bingo, A razor and the Thuringian. He told me that a dealer had gotten some stuff. So I went to that dealer's /garage sale/home sale and found the other two hones. I have found things where there had been none the week before and known of others finding things at a place where I had just struck out at the week before.
